Reviews of Taeko Kunishima
09/10/2006 Chris Parker | Taeko Kunishima has clearly thoroughly assimilated, rather than simply dipped into, her varied sources, and the result is an absorbing mix of affectingly melancholic themes with more up-tempo quartet workouts from a punchy, fiercely interactive, cohesive band that promises to deliver in spades in live performance
| 16/03/2006 All About Jazz by Dan McClenaghan | Kunishima's jazz compositions lean toward lyricism and delicacy, catchy melodies and occasional driving grooves.... adding a touch of the exotic to the jazz sound.
| 09/03/2006 Chris Parker, Vortex jazz review page | florid lyricism alternating with passages of robust jazz improvisation to produce an intriguingly varied but cogent set.
| 09/04/0005 Isle of Wight International Jazz Divas Festival | Startlingly original pianist, blending Japanese folk music with early 20th century French Impressionism, and oblique yet infectious jazz sensibillity echoing Thelonious Monk. |
